Inadequate Flashing Installment
Picking the ideal products isn't the only element that can bring about roof covering troubles; poor blinking installment can likewise produce considerable problems. Flashing is important for guiding water away from susceptible locations, such as chimneys, skylights, and roof covering valleys. If it's not mounted effectively, you take the chance of water breach, which can result in mold and mildew growth and architectural damage.
When you set up flashing, ensure it's the right kind for your roof covering's design and the local environment. For instance, metal blinking is typically extra long lasting than plastic in locations with hefty rainfall or snow. See to it the blinking overlaps suitably and is safeguarded securely to stop voids where water can leak with.
You must likewise focus on the installment angle. Blinking should be positioned to route water far from the house, not toward it.

Neglecting Air Flow Needs
While many homeowners concentrate on the visual and structural facets of roof setup, ignoring ventilation needs can lead to significant long-term consequences. Correct ventilation is crucial for controling temperature and wetness levels in your attic, preventing issues like mold development, timber rot, and ice dams. If you do not mount adequate air flow, you're setting your roofing up for failure.
To prevent this error, initially, assess your home's certain ventilation demands. A well balanced system commonly includes both intake and exhaust vents to promote air movement. Guarantee you've set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the optimal of your roofing system. This combination enables hot air to get away while cooler air goes into, maintaining your attic room space comfy.
Additionally, think about the sort of roofing material you've selected. Some materials might require additional air flow methods. Verify your regional building ordinance for air flow standards, as they can differ substantially.
Ultimately, do not neglect to inspect your air flow system on a regular basis. Obstructions from debris or insulation can impede airflow, so maintain those vents clear.
